Use Application's getURL:
mx.core.Application.getURL("index.html");

Subject: [flexcoders] alert listener I have an alert
listener thats instantiated upon login to my application like
so: public var
alertListener:Object = new Object(); function
createListener() {
alertListener.click = function(event) {
getURL("index.html");
} } Then I have a method
that is called when the application session has ended like
so: public function
sessionEnded():Void {
mx.controls.Alert.show("Your session has ended and you must log back into the
site.", "Session Alert",
mx.controls.Alert.OK, this, alertListener, "",
mx.controls.Alert.OK); } When the user clicks on
a link and the session has ended, it pops up the alert window successfully,
telling them they must log in again
I had hoped that after reading this message
and clicking ok, the application would refresh and theyd be presented with the
login screen again, only thing is, getURL buried in the createListener() method
isnt working
Ive put trace statements in there
its getting there
it just
doesnt want to get me my URL. Does this have something to do with scoping
here? Is there a way to do this properly, scope-wise if that is in fact
the case so my call to getURL actually does work? robert l.
